Changes in the ECM of the lung during ageing, such as loss of elastin and increased collagen contributes to aberrant composition that negatively influences proliferation, migration and differentiation of cells. Idiopathic pulmonary fibrosis (IPF) is a devastating interstitial lung disease of unknown aetiology that is characterised by exaggerated deposition of extracellular matrix (ECM) leading to an irreversible decline in lung function and ultimately death. |

In conclusion, we have shown that fibroblast exposed to ctrl- or ipf-derived ecm under nonstimulated conditions does not induce cellular senescence. instead, we observed upregulation of proinflammatory cytokines and profibrotic cytokines in response to senescent or profibrotic ecm. these data suggest that, to induce a strong response to their environment, not only is composition important in ipf but a secondary stimulant that induces dna damage such as ros, or pathological stiffness might be required to create a positive feedback look that perpetuates fibrosis in ipf. |
